Summary
Members of the Army Ski Troops (later the 10th Mountain Division) watch as a man identified as McNamara demonstrates the use of a "Swiss" shoulder belay in rock climbing for an MGM training film in Sun Valley (Blaine County), Idaho. The men wear uniforms that include parkas and caps. Three of the men have rifles and knapsacks, one man has a sword attached to his knapsack.
